Indoor air quality testing is a professional service that examines and evaluates the air inside residential and commercial spaces to detect harmful pollutants, locate emission origins, and evaluate air exchange efficiency. This comprehensive assessment helps reveal contaminants that can affect health, comfort, and overall well-being, often at levels higher than outdoor air. According to the EPA's Indoor Air Quality guide, individuals spend approximately 90% of their time indoors, where air pollution levels can be 2–5 times greater than external air due to restricted air exchange and common indoor sources. In Southern California, distinct environmental conditions like smoke penetration from wildfires, dense urban traffic particulates, and increased moisture from coastal areas substantially heighten concerns, making indoor air quality testing critically essential for uncovering hidden risks such as particulate matter (PM2.5), volatile organic compounds (VOCs), mold spores, formaldehyde, and deficient ventilation signals. Indoor air quality testing systematically examines indoor environments to quantify airborne contaminants, evaluate air exchange rates, and pinpoint contamination points that compromise health and comfort. The process identifies a wide range of contaminants including particulate matter (PM2.5), volatile organic compounds (VOCs), mold spores, formaldehyde, elevated carbon dioxide, and naturally occurring radon. Modern sealed structures retain pollutants released by construction materials, household cleaners, fuel-burning devices, and personal products, frequently creating indoor levels much greater than external air. Professional-grade indoor air quality testing employs calibrated sensors, time-integrated sampling devices, and accredited lab protocols to deliver objective, scientifically validated findings that do-it-yourself kits fall short of achieving in terms of reliability and detail.
According to standards established by leading organizations, indoor pollution originates from internal emissions (like material off-gassing) and external intrusion (vehicle exhaust or wildfire smoke), with poor ventilation increasing the severity of exposure. Outdoor environments benefit from constant atmospheric mixing and dilution by wind and weather patterns, rapidly diluting pollutants. In contrast, indoor spaces feature limited air exchange, especially in energy-efficient modern construction, causing VOCs, fine particulates, and biological contaminants to accumulate over time. This difference accounts for why many people notice stronger reactions inside even when outdoor air quality appears satisfactory. Poorly maintained HVAC systems can further recirculate contaminants, establishing ongoing exposure patterns.
Regional microclimate differences in Southern California generate complex exposure risks: recurring wildfire events bring PM2.5 deep indoors, urban corridors contribute traffic-related particulates, and higher coastal moisture encourages mold and allergen proliferation. These regional factors, combined with typical household sources, create elevated indoor risks that demand specialized indoor air quality testing to defend at-risk populations like kids, elderly residents, and those with asthma or allergies. The pollutant profile in Southern California residences reflects a complex interplay of natural, urban, and indoor-generated sources. Particulate matter (PM2.5) from wildfire events infiltrates structures and persists in HVAC systems, while volatile organic compounds (VOCs) continuously off-gas from paints, furnishings, and household cleaners. Formaldehyde emerges from composite wood products and insulation materials, mold spores proliferate in humid microenvironments, and elevated carbon dioxide levels indicate inadequate fresh air exchange. These contaminants interact synergistically, typically producing additive health impacts that appear as persistent irritation, breathing difficulties, or reduced mental clarity.
PM2.5 particles measure 2.5 micrometers or smaller and penetrate deeply into lung tissue, triggering inflammatory responses and exacerbating existing respiratory conditions. During and after wildfire seasons, wildfire particulates infiltrate homes through openings, vents, and HVAC systems, leaving behind particles that keep emitting irritants long after external levels drop.
Deposited particles get stirred up by movement, heating/cooling systems, and normal use, keeping higher indoor levels persisting well beyond outdoor smoke reduction. Professional sampling captures these dynamic patterns, providing data that guides effective remediation strategies.
Children and elderly individuals face greater vulnerability due to developing or declining respiratory systems, causing higher rates of asthma exacerbations, diminished respiratory function, and increased cardiovascular vulnerability from extended PM2.5 contact.
VOCs release from everyday materials like coatings, bonding agents, cleaning products, and personal items, leading to ocular, nasal, and throat discomfort, as well as headaches and dizziness. Formaldehyde, considered a probable carcinogen to humans, releases from composite wood materials, insulation products, and fabrics, creating heightened concern in fresh construction or renovated areas during peak emission periods.
Increased humidity—prevalent in coastal areas of Southern California—provide optimal environments for mold growth, dust mites, and biological allergens in concealed areas including wall voids, attics, and heating/cooling systems. These biological contaminants cause allergic responses, asthma attacks, and immune reactions in susceptible people, especially in areas near the ocean or with higher moisture.
Increased CO₂ readings function as trustworthy signs of poor ventilation, correlating with accumulation of other contaminants and reduced cognitive performance. Radon, a radioactive soil gas that is invisible and odorless, migrates upward from soil in certain rock formations and builds up in basements or slab-on-grade areas, necessitating specific monitoring to evaluate chronic exposure potential.

Expert practitioners employ three fundamental methodologies to obtain complete measurements: instantaneous measurement, composite sampling, and targeted contaminant-specific testing. These synergistic techniques provide complete assessment of both immediate conditions and average long-term exposure.
Mobile, sophisticated sensors offer real-time data of particulate matter (PM2.5), carbon dioxide, relative humidity, temperature, and volatile gases, facilitating fast recognition of urgent issues and fluctuating patterns during normal use.
Time-integrated collection devices capture air over extended periods (hours to days), generating average exposure data that accredited laboratories then measure with outstanding accuracy for VOCs, mold spores, and other complex mixtures.
When particular substances are suspected based on symptoms, building history, or regional factors, specialized protocols focus on high-priority threats like radon or formaldehyde, producing conclusive data for critical substances.

Professional indoor air quality testing employs a rigorous, systematic protocol designed to produce reliable, verifiable results while minimizing disruption to occupants. The process begins with detailed consultation, progresses through thorough on-site evaluation and sampling, advances to laboratory processing, and concludes with comprehensive reporting and actionable recommendations tailored to the specific findings.
The process begins with detailed conversation about observed symptoms, property history, recent modifications, and local environmental influences that may influence indoor air quality.
Information about previous renovations, appliance usage, proximity to roadways, or wildfire exposure helps prioritize sampling locations and contaminant targets.
Prompt identification of water damage, ventilation problems, or strong-emission materials enables streamlined, targeted evaluation planning.
Technicians conduct a comprehensive visual assessment for signs of water damage, microbial growth, dust accumulation, or ventilation problems while concurrently gathering immediate measurements of critical indicators.
Careful positioning of collection equipment gathers representative samples from occupied spaces, bedrooms, and suspected trouble spots to capture genuine exposure experienced by residents.
Specimens are subjected to detailed testing in accredited, third-party laboratories applying approved laboratory procedures to determine and quantify contaminants with superior precision.
Property owners obtain a well-structured report including data interpretation, source determination, health significance, and ordered corrective recommendations covering everything from ventilation optimization to focused source reduction.

Proper scheduling optimizes the benefits of indoor air quality testing. Consider scheduling after major environmental incidents, structural changes, seasonal shifts, or when ongoing symptoms indicate an indoor cause.
frequent headaches, irritation of eyes/nose/throat, unexplained tiredness, aggravated asthma, or sleep problems often indicate higher indoor pollutant levels needing assessment.
Post-wildfire recovery periods, major renovations, new construction, or prolonged humid conditions greatly elevate exposure risks and warrant immediate evaluation.
Annual or biennial evaluations help maintain optimal conditions in regions with elevated environmental challenges, while more regular testing benefits homes with vulnerable occupants.
Follow-up testing confirms the effectiveness of previous interventions, while pre-purchase inspections uncover potential problems before closing on a property.

Indoor air quality testing pricing depends on extent and geographic area. Standard residential evaluations typically fall between $300 and $800, covering typical pollutant detection with basic collection and accredited laboratory processing. More extensive packages that encompass multiple collection sites, specialized pollutant testing, smoke-related analysis, or larger-scale commercial facilities generally range from $1,000 to $2,000+.
Basic assessments focus on prevalent threats such as PM2.5 and VOCs, whereas advanced packages extend to cover formaldehyde, radon, in-depth mold identification, and post-remediation confirmation.
Property square footage, number of sampling points, urgency requirements, travel distance, and additional specialized analyses determine total cost while maintaining transparent pricing structures.
